I hace scored 47.23 percentage in 12th from PCB so can i become physiotherapist???

To be a Physiotherapist you have to pursue the course BPT. For BPT the eligibility criteria is:

  • Should have passed 10+2 with a minimum of 50 percent marks from a recognized institute.

  • Should have completed 10+2 having PCB as compulsory subjects.

  • Candidates should have passed in English.

  • Candidates should have completed the age of 17 years at the time of admission.

As you have less marks in 10+2 then you are ineligible for the course in most of the colleges. But there might be some college which may give you admission but the possibility is very less.
